The TEAS (Test of Essential Academic Skills) is a standardized entrance exam required by most nursing and health science programs across the country. It assesses your knowledge in reading, math, science, and English language skills. Scoring well on the TEAS is critical for admission to nursing schools and other allied health programs, making targeted preparation essential for students in St. Louis pursuing healthcare careers.
Many students struggle with the science section, particularly anatomy, physiology, and biology concepts that require deep understanding rather than memorization. The math portion also challenges students who haven't used algebra or basic calculations in a while. Additionally, the time pressure of the exam—you have just over 3 hours to complete 170 questions—can cause anxiety. Practice testing is essential because it builds familiarity with the exam format, pacing, and question types while revealing exactly where you need to focus. Taking full-length practice tests under timed conditions helps you develop stamina and identify patterns in the questions you miss. Your tutor will use practice test results to guide your study plan, ensuring you're drilling the right concepts and building the test-taking strategies that work best for you.
